Used in Herbal Medicine to help maintain a healthy immune system.
Astragalus is used to treat colds and upper respiratory infections, to strengthen and regulate the immune system, and to increase the production of white blood cells, particularly in individuals with chronic degenerative disease. It is also an antibacterial, antiviral tonic, liver protectant, anti-inflammatory and antioxidant.
Children (2-4 years): 0.33-0.5 ml (10-15 drops)
Children (5-9 years): 0.5-0.75 ml (15-22 drops)
Children (10 - 14 years): 1-1.5 ml (30-45 drops)
Adults & adolescents (15 & over): 2-3 ml (60-90 drops).
All St. Francis Astragalus doses should be taken 2 times daily in a little water or juice on an empty stomach.
